The Transportation Specialist plays a crucial role in providing safe and reliable transportation for adults with disabilities. This position involves driving a 14-passenger bus to facilitate travel from residential areas to adult day training facilities.
Key Responsibilities- Ensure the safe transport of clients to and from designated locations.
- Maintain a schedule that includes morning and afternoon shifts, typically from 6 am to 10 am and 2 pm to 6 pm.
- Adapt to route changes as necessary to meet the needs of clients.
The working hours are structured to provide essential services during peak times, with a midday break included.
QualificationsIdeal candidates should possess a valid driver's license and have a commitment to providing excellent service to individuals with disabilities.
